makVrv::DtExtrudedPolygonModelInstance Class Reference

A prism controlled by control points. More...

Inheritance diagram for makVrv::DtExtrudedPolygonModelInstance:
Inheritance graph
[legend]

Public Member Functions

 DtExtrudedPolygonModelInstance (DtDe &de)
 CTOR.
virtual ~DtExtrudedPolygonModelInstance ()
 DTOR.
virtual void setFill (bool)
 Sets whether or not polygon is filled or just an outline (default is false)
virtual void setPolygonMode (DtExtrudedPolygonModel::PolygonMode mode)
 Sets the mode of the polygon (by default top and bottom)
virtual void updateGeometry ()
 If polygons need updating, also update them.
virtual void setInsideColor (float r, float g, float b, float a)
 Set the inside color of the line.
virtual void getInsideColor (float &r, float &g, float &b, float &a) const
 Gets the inside color of the line.
virtual void setOutsideColor (float r, float g, float b, float a)
 Set the outside color of the line.
virtual void getOutsideColor (float &r, float &g, float &b, float &a) const
 Gets the outside color of the line.
virtual void setColor (float r, float g, float b, float a)
 Sets the inside and outside color.
